Sewer line unclogging services involve the use of specialized equipment and techniques to clear blockages within a home's main sewer line. Over time, debris such as grease, hair, soap scum, and foreign objects can accumulate and cause obstructions that prevent wastewater from flowing freely. Service providers typically perform thorough inspections to identify the location and cause of the clog, then employ methods like high-pressure water jetting or cable augering to remove the blockage. This process helps restore proper drainage and prevents potential backups that could lead to more serious plumbing issues.

Clogged sewer lines can lead to a variety of problems for homeowners, including slow drains, foul odors, gurgling sounds in plumbing fixtures, or sewage backups in toilets and sinks. These issues often indicate a blockage that needs professional attention. Ignoring such signs can result in water damage, unpleasant odors, and costly repairs. Sewer line unclogging services are designed to address these problems quickly and effectively, helping homeowners avoid more extensive damage and maintain a healthy, functional plumbing system.

This service is commonly used by residential properties, including single-family homes, duplexes, and small apartment buildings. Any property that relies on a shared sewer system may encounter issues with clogged lines, especially if there are older pipes or a history of heavy use. Additionally, properties with trees nearby can experience root intrusion, which can cause blockages that require professional removal. The overview below groups typical Sewer Line Unclogging proj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Ontario, CA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ine unclogging of residential drains in Ontario, CA range from $150 to $350. Many common j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the severity and accessibility of the clog.

Moderate Blockages - More involved sewer line issues, such as partial blockages or minor pipe damage, often cost between $350 and $1,000. Larger, more complex projects in this range are less frequent but may include additional diagnostics or minor repairs.

Major Repairs - Extensive repairs or replacements of sewer lines can range from $1,000 to $3,500. These projects are less common and usually involve significant pipe damage or root intrusion requiring specialized equipment.

Full Line Replacement - Complete sewer line replacements typically cost $4,000 or more, with larger, more complex projects reaching $5,000+. Many service providers handle projects in this range, though they are less frequent than routine or moderate jobs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es sewer lines to become clogged? Common causes include buildup of debris, grease, hair, and foreign objects that obstruct flow within the pipes.

How do professionals typically unclog sewer lines? They often use specialized tools like drain snakes or hydro-jetting equipment to remove blockages effectively.

Are there signs indicating a sewer line might be clogged? Yes, signs include slow drains, foul odors, gurgling sounds, or sewage backups in fixtures.

Can sewer line clogs be prevented? Regular maintenance and avoiding flushing or pouring substances that can cause buildup can help prevent clogs.
